This is an 8.3 mile loop hike with around a 2,300 elevation gain. We will hike it in the counterclockwise direction going up White Oak Canyon and coming down Cedar Run. The trails here can be steep and challenging but that's the price we'll have to pay for the views and waterfalls. We'll be hiking at a 2-2.5 MPH pace slowing down for the inclines and photo ops.
